Research Project ActivityResearch Project Activity
Publisher
Curated OER
Curator Rating
Educator Rating
Not yet Rated
Activity

Research Project

Curated and Reviewed by Lesson Planet

Students fill out a form which asked the WHO, WHAT, WHEN, WHERE, and WHY about the person they were assigned to research, they gather their information from different web sites on Lightspan and Yahooligans. They create a HyperStudio and Claris Works project.
